#578404 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#578404 is composed of 34.1% red, 51.8%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 97% yellow and 48.2% black. It has a hue angle of 81.1 degrees, a saturation of 94.1% and a lightness of 26.7%. #578404 color hex could be obtained by blending #aeff08 with #000900. Closest websafe color is: #669900.

#578404 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#578404 has RGB values of R:87, G:132,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0.34, M:0, Y:0.97, K:0.48. Its decimal value is 5735428.
